Forest Hill Tutoring has a long history of supporting student success.  For almost three decades, we have worked closely with students, parents and teachers in identifying needs, establishing goals and designing programs that challenge and inspire.  Our one-on-one tutoring services include regular or occasional homework and curriculum support as well as more tailored sessions aimed at providing specific enrichment or remedial instruction in key skills and subject areas.

We pride ourselves on both the flexibility of our services and our student-centered approach. All of our tutors are subject specialists, many with graduate degrees and teaching certification, and all share a passion for teaching and learning. They strive to convey how to learn, and not just what to learn, and incorporate critical thinking and effective study skills into each session.

We provide tutoring support in all subjects, from junior kindergarten to postsecondary, and have extensive experience with a wide range of curricula, including Advanced Placement (AP) and International Baccalaureate (IB) programs. We also offer more general organizational support for clients wishing to develop targeted planning, scheduling and time-management skills. 

Tutoring services are conducted on-site at our tutoring centre, as well as online through the videoconferencing platform of the client’s choice.


We recognize that the current pandemic poses unique challenges for students, especially those adjusting to “hybrid” teaching models and other changes to their classroom learning. With this in mind, we are excited to offer our new Learning Pods. Each Learning Pod supports 1-3 students on the days they are engaged in remote learning outside of their regular classrooms.

Whether it is clarifying the previous day’s lesson or reinforcing new concepts through assigned online activities - our tutors can assist your child through a structured and supportive environment that complements their in-class learning.  Please note that Learning Pods require a minimum two-hour booking per session. Clients are encouraged to develop their own “pods” of interested students of the same household or academic/social circle.



  • General
  • Functions
  • Advanced Functions
  • Calculus and Vectors
  • Data Management
  • Statistics

English Language and Literature

  • Grammar and Composition
  • Essay Writing and Editing
  • ESL Support
  • Creative Writing
  • Literature Study

International Languages

  • French
  • Spanish
  • German
  • Latin
  • Ancient Greek
  • Others


  • General
  • Biology
  • Chemistry
  • Physics
  • Environmental

Business Studies

  • General
  • Accounting
  • Macroeconomics
  • Microeconomics
  • Finance

Computer Science

  • Python
  • Java
  • C / C++
  • Others


  • American History
  • Canadian History
  • Classical Studies
  • World History

Cultural Studies

  • Art and Art History
  • Film Studies
  • Media

Global Studies

  • Canadian and International Politics
  • Philosophy
  • Civics
  • Law
  • Human and Natural Geography

Social Sciences

  • Psychology
  • Anthropology
  • Sociology